Indulge in one of Burgundy’s most prestigious white wines with the Bouchard Père & Fils Montrachet Grand Cru 2021. Produced in the heart of the Côte de Beaune, this 100% Chardonnay showcases the absolute peak of French white winemaking.

Crafted by the historic estate of Bouchard Père & Fils, this exceptional vintage was aged for 12 months in French oak barrels, resulting in a rich, complex structure and remarkable finesse. The bouquet is intense and layered, revealing refined floral notes, citrus, and orchard fruits, all gracefully interwoven with a subtle toasted oak character.

This Grand Cru strikes a perfect balance of power, smoothness, and elegance, making it not only delightful now but also a superb cellaring investment with significant ageing potential.

Winery

Bouchard produces wines ranging from Cotes de Nuits in the North to Beaujolais in the South. All of these wines are produced and aged at the Cuverie Saint Vincent in Savigny-les-Beaune. Regional and Village Appellations—Bouchard Pere & Fils owns 44 hectares of vineyards in the village and regional appellations.
Premier Crus – accounts for the biggest number of Burgundy’s appellations but represent 15% of total production. Bouchard produces 28 Premiers Crus from their 74-hectare holding. Their smallest Premier Cru parcel is Gevrey-Chambertin “Les Cazetiers” at 0.25ha, and their largest is Savigny-les-Beaune “Les Lavieres” at 3.9ha.
Grand Crus – accounts for only 2% of Burgundian production. This category includes 33 appellations, of which Bouchard owns 10 parcels (12 hectares). The smallest parcel is Batard-Montrachet at 0.7 ha, and the largest is Le Corton Charlemagne at 3.65 ha.
